### Bounce Processor — plugin notes

The Mailhollow bounce processor parses incoming bounce notifications and dispatches them to registered plugins. Plugins receive normalized bounce events (hard, soft, complaint) and must return within the handler timeout or the event is requeued. Hard bounces suppress the address globally; soft bounces increment a counter that plugins may inspect. When testing locally, run the processor against the sandbox mailbox, which starts with these configuration values.

settings of bafof-fajog:
[aldix]
port = 9300
region = north-3
host = aldix.kelvilabs.example
team = istath
timeout_ms = 1500
retries = 8

**Mgmt Meeting Minutes — Retiring the Brightline Range**

Quick recap for sales leads at Fenholt Supplies: we agreed to retire the Brightline fixture range by year-end. Remaining stock moves to clearance pricing next month, and accounts on standing orders get migrated to the Lumetta range. Trade-in incentives were approved in principle. The confidential note on next steps sits just below.

board note of bajof-bajeg: The pricing group signed off on a budget of $13.4 million for Project Sildor. The renewal with Lamixek Holdings closes at $48.9 million a year, 49 percent above the last contract.

## Local Setup — Hermit Migration

Brief for the eng sync: Carthview's build now runs under the Sealcrate hermetic toolchain. Delete stale `out/` dirs first. Fetch the pinned toolchain bundle, then run the bootstrap target; no system compilers are consulted. Cache priming takes ~10 minutes on first run. The migration tracker database records per-target conversion status. Point your client at it with this connection string.

primary connection of tawif-yajeg = postgresql://rusiel_svc:G879q9cx6GsSvj@db-dd9f.norvagrid.internal:5432/casath

Subject: Cron-to-Windmere cut-over summary

Hello plugin authors — as of this morning, all scheduled jobs on the Larkspur platform have been migrated from host-level cron to the Windmere workflow engine. Legacy crontabs have been disabled but preserved for thirty days. Plugins registering scheduled tasks must now declare them via the Windmere manifest; direct cron registration will be rejected. The engine settings your plugins will run under are the following.

settings of kahag-bagug:
[quenath]
port = 6379
region = outer-2
host = quenath.nelvrocorp.internal
timeout_ms = 2000
retries = 3